A huge thank you to Kerry Castledine for generously sponsoring our U16 National Squad. Read the article to find out more about Kerry and her business.

Hi I’m Kerry, from Kerry Castledine Coaching. I am a Certified Life Coach, Personal Development Coach, Grief & Loss Coach and an accredited Mental Health England First Aider.

I am passionate about supporting mental health and well-being, and creating balance and empowerment in my clients.

The main role of a coach is to enable and empower YOU as a client to connect the dots, see yourself through an unclouded lens, and use with clarity the resources that are already inside of you. This helps to unlock the immense potential that is often buried through layers of conditioning. Whilst therapists may look to the past for answers, the coach deals with the now and the future.

There are many stressors in our lives that create exhaustion, lack of self-esteem, feelings of being stuck and unsure of the future. We have so many roles in our every day life that at times we can disconnect from who we really are, putting ourselves way down the list, and it’s worth noting that if we aren’t speaking it, we are storing it, and that gets heavy.
Reese Witherspoon was quoted as saying “With the right kind of coaching and determination you can accomplish anything”

There are some worrying statistics out there at the moment, MHFA England state that “more than 75% of adults accessing treatment now had a diagnosable condition prior to the age of 18”. Whilst we have all been affected by the huge impact of COVID and recent events, our younger generation have had the added pressures and stressors of interrupted and isolated education. When you look at our current athletes, not only do they have to deal with this, they also want to perform at their best regardless of these conditions, and we, as parents need to support them. Everyone’s well-being and mental health is paramount right now.
